Novità

Come scrivere i risultati in "orizzontale" anzichè in "verticale"

lotto_tom75

Advanced Premium Member
Cerco di spiegarmi meglio...

con questo pezzo di codice:

Codice:
Call Scrivi(StringaNumeri(acol)) & "."

Se inserito in un for...

si ha in output qualcosa di questo tipo

1.
2.
3.
4.

ecc...

mentre io vorrei avere i risultanti visibili in "orizzontale" ovvero:

1.2.3.4. ecc...

Come ,se fattibile, posso modificare la riga di codice soprastante, possibilmente senza ricorrere ad array, a tal fine?

Grazie
 
Ultima modifica:
Ciao , tom
Dim aV:av= array ( 0,1,2 ,3 ,4 ,5)
Dim i
For i =1 to ubound (av)
Scrivi av(i),,0
Next

Ciao legend grazie mille ma sopra mi ero dimenticato di scrivere "senza ricorrere ad array". Essendo valori dinamici vorrei evitare di ricorrere all'inserimento nell''array se possibile... Grazie comunque amico :)
 
Tom ,se fai l esempio è più facile aiutarti .
In ogni caso o costruisci una stringa e scrivi dopo il ciclo, oppure nel ciclo metti zero alla seconda virgola.
Ciao :)
 
Tom ,se fai l esempio è più facile aiutarti .
In ogni caso o costruisci una stringa e scrivi dopo il ciclo, oppure nel ciclo metti zero alla seconda virgola.
Ciao :)

Ecco legend un codice di esempio che vorrei modificare in modo che scriva i risultati in orizzontale anzichè uno sotto l'altro e possibilmente non ricorrendo all'array...


Codice:
Do While GetCombSviluppo(acol) = True
         Call StatisticaFormazioneFT(acol,nSorte,RetRit,RetRitMax,RetIncrRitMax,RetFreq,Inizio,Fine)
         RetRit = RitardoCombinazioneFT(acol,nSorte,Fine)
         Dim Diff
         Diff = RetRitMax - RetRit
  
         If(RetRit >= 0 And RetFreq > 1) Then
        
            Call Scrivi(StringaNumeri(acol))
       
        End If
    
      If ScriptInterrotto Then Exit Do
      Loop

:)
 
Tom prova a vedere la funzione scrivi e le sue voci.
Non ho il pc ,non posso postare script di esempio.
Ciao .
 
Cerco di spiegarmi meglio...

con questo pezzo di codice:

Codice:
Call Scrivi(StringaNumeri(acol)) & "."

Se inserito in un for...

si ha in output qualcosa di questo tipo

1.
2.
3.
4.

ecc...

mentre io vorrei avere i risultanti visibili in "orizzontale" ovvero:

1.2.3.4. ecc...

Come ,se fattibile, posso modificare la riga di codice soprastante, possibilmente senza ricorrere ad array, a tal fine?

Grazie


Ciao a Tutti

Questo tipo di problema l'avevo anchio quando mi sono cimentato per le prime volte a fare gli script ed in questo link

al post 80, io chiedo più o meno come avere i risultati in orizontale, e nei post seguenti Mike58 mi spiega come fare
 

Ultima estrazione Lotto

  • Estrazione del lotto
    martedì 01 luglio 2025
    Bari
    71
    66
    48
    42
    76
    Cagliari
    84
    70
    23
    69
    43
    Firenze
    50
    21
    30
    11
    69
    Genova
    89
    41
    50
    80
    67
    Milano
    41
    59
    67
    03
    60
    Napoli
    87
    63
    51
    42
    07
    Palermo
    56
    87
    76
    27
    09
    Roma
    41
    26
    50
    22
    77
    Torino
    36
    83
    80
    65
    05
    Venezia
    45
    77
    76
    81
    71
    Nazionale
    72
    06
    03
    08
    07
    Estrazione Simbolotto
    Nazionale
    34
    27
    08
    12
    17
Indietro
Alto